I have often herad that, while These filters look beautiful and the engine is louder, as the engine is then breathing warmer air from directly above the engine, it doesn´t help for more power, more loosing a bit.
Don´t know if it´s a big difference.

The original filter from where he takes the air ?
Fourteen centimeter below ;)
I have no idea whether what you've heard is true .
These filters were produced for the Stratos, so I think they had some vantage for engine, one of them is that not smudge carbs with the recovery oil vapors .
For example, my father bought his Fiat Dino Coupé with the original filter, after installed the Colombo filters and did not remove them more because he believed that the engine would work much better.
But it was forty years ago ...
